.elementor-2432 .elementor-element.elementor-element-1d77948{--display:flex;--gap:1.25rem 1.25rem;--row-gap:1.25rem;--column-gap:1.25rem;--background-transition:0.3s;--padding-top:2.25rem;--padding-bottom:2.25rem;--padding-left:2.25rem;--padding-right:2.25rem;}.elementor-2432 .elementor-element.elementor-element-1d77948:not(.elementor-motion-effects-element-type-background), .elementor-2432 .elementor-element.elementor-element-1d77948 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-b7cfbbb );}.elementor-2432 .elementor-element.elementor-element-1d77948:hover{background-color:var( --e-global-color-primary );}.elementor-2432 .elementor-element.elementor-element-e043688 .jet-listing-dynamic-field__content{color:var( --e-global-color-accent );font-family:var( --e-global-typography-c6f7464-font-family ), Sans-serif;font-size:var( --e-global-typography-c6f7464-font-size );font-weight:var( --e-global-typography-c6f7464-font-weight );text-transform:var( --e-global-typography-c6f7464-text-transform );letter-spacing:var( --e-global-typography-c6f7464-letter-spacing );text-align:left;}.elementor-2432 .elementor-element.elementor-element-5b9e54b .jet-listing-dynamic-field__content{font-family:var( --e-global-typography-b8d96b7-font-family ), Sans-serif;font-size:var( --e-global-typography-b8d96b7-font-size );font-weight:var( --e-global-typography-b8d96b7-font-weight );line-height:var( --e-global-typography-b8d96b7-line-height );text-align:left;}.elementor-2432 .elementor-element.elementor-element-ae090c1 .jet-listing-dynamic-field__content{font-family:var( --e-global-typography-3777481-font-family ), Sans-serif;font-size:var( --e-global-typography-3777481-font-size );font-weight:var( --e-global-typography-3777481-font-weight );line-height:var( --e-global-typography-3777481-line-height );text-align:left;}@media(min-width:2400px){.elementor-2432 .elementor-element.elementor-element-e043688 .jet-listing-dynamic-field__content{font-size:var( --e-global-typography-c6f7464-font-size );letter-spacing:var( --e-global-typography-c6f7464-letter-spacing );}.elementor-2432 .elementor-element.elementor-element-5b9e54b .jet-listing-dynamic-field__content{font-size:var( --e-global-typography-b8d96b7-font-size );line-height:var( --e-global-typography-b8d96b7-line-height );}.elementor-2432 .elementor-element.elementor-element-ae090c1 .jet-listing-dynamic-field__content{font-size:var( --e-global-typography-3777481-font-size );line-height:var( --e-global-typography-3777481-line-height );}}@media(max-width:1024px){.elementor-2432 .elementor-element.elementor-element-e043688 .jet-listing-dynamic-field__content{font-size:var( --e-global-typography-c6f7464-font-size );letter-spacing:var( --e-global-typography-c6f7464-letter-spacing );}.elementor-2432 .elementor-element.elementor-element-5b9e54b .jet-listing-dynamic-field__content{font-size:var( --e-global-typography-b8d96b7-font-size );line-height:var( --e-global-typography-b8d96b7-line-height );}.elementor-2432 .elementor-element.elementor-element-ae090c1 .jet-listing-dynamic-field__content{font-size:var( --e-global-typography-3777481-font-size );line-height:var( --e-global-typography-3777481-line-height );}}@media(max-width:767px){.elementor-2432 .elementor-element.elementor-element-e043688 .jet-listing-dynamic-field__content{font-size:var( --e-global-typography-c6f7464-font-size );letter-spacing:var( --e-global-typography-c6f7464-letter-spacing );}.elementor-2432 .elementor-element.elementor-element-5b9e54b .jet-listing-dynamic-field__content{font-size:var( --e-global-typography-b8d96b7-font-size );line-height:var( --e-global-typography-b8d96b7-line-height );}.elementor-2432 .elementor-element.elementor-element-ae090c1 .jet-listing-dynamic-field__content{font-size:var( --e-global-typography-3777481-font-size );line-height:var( --e-global-typography-3777481-line-height );}}/* Start custom CSS for container, class: .elementor-element-1d77948 */.servicio-card:hover .servicio-title .jet-listing-dynamic-field__content {
	color: white;
}

.servicio-card:hover .servicio-excerpt .jet-listing-dynamic-field__content {
	color: var( --e-global-color-da95f4e );
}

.servicio-card:hover .servicio-buton .elementor-button {
	color: var( --e-global-color-accent );
	border-bottom: 1.5px solid var( --e-global-color-accent );
}

.servicio-card:hover .servicio-cat .jet-listing-dynamic-field__content {
    color: var( --e-global-color-0404c25 );
}/* End custom CSS */